Why “Ten Minutes” Works (and Why Longer Usually Fails)

Morning routines win when they are short, consistent, and low-friction. By the time students walk in, they’re still switching gears from home life to school expectations. A long start-up routine can accidentally train your class to dread the first minutes of the day.

Ten minutes works because it hits a sweet spot:

  • Short enough that most kids can begin without arguing.
  • Predictable enough that they know what’s coming.
  • Focused enough that students can actually finish, which builds confidence.
  • Frequent enough to keep skills fresh across weeks.

Think of it like brushing teeth. No one wants to brush for an hour. But daily brushing prevents bigger problems later.

What Morning Work Should Actually Do for 5th Grade Math

A common mistake is treating morning work like “extra practice” with no clear purpose. Better: use morning work to support what kids will need later that day, next lesson, or next unit.

For 5th grade math, morning warm-ups should strengthen these areas consistently:

  • Number sense (place value, relationships between numbers, rounding)
  • Operations (multi-digit multiplication/division, multi-step word problems)
  • Fractions and decimals (equivalency, compare/order, operations)
  • Geometry basics (perimeter/area concepts, angles, coordinates)
  • Problem-solving habits (reading carefully, selecting strategies, checking reasonableness)

The key is that morning work should be skill-specific but cognitively doable. Your goal is progress without overwhelm.

The “Warm-up” Mindset: Don’t Use Homework Energy in the Morning

Warm-ups should feel like the first minutes of gym class, not the final exam.

If students are copying directions for 2 minutes, hunting for supplies for 3 minutes, and confused for 4 minutes, then your “warm-up” isn’t a warm-up. It’s a stress test.

Instead, design morning work so students are doing meaningful math within the first minute or two.

Here’s what that looks like in practice:

  • Clear, predictable format (same section headings every day)
  • Tiny task size (most items can be completed in under 30 to 60 seconds)
  • Built-in scaffolds (number lines, visual models, word problem frames)
  • Quick check (students self-check or you collect in under 2 minutes)

The Morning Routine Structure (10 Minutes Total)

Use this schedule for a smooth, repeatable flow. It’s detailed, but you can scale it to your style.

Minute 0–2: Arrival + Start Signal

  • Students enter and begin the “Start Line” page.
  • Directions are printed on the page in student-friendly language.
  • You give a one-sentence launch: “Do the first problem, then wait for the timer.”

Minute 2–8: Solve the Warm-up

  • Students work independently.
  • You circulate and handle only the highest-priority misunderstandings (not every question).

Minute 8–10: Check + Reset

  • Students check answers (answer key on board, sticky notes, or partner verification).
  • Students circle “Got it” or “Need help” and place their page in a designated spot.

The Five Components of a Student-Approved Math Warm-up

To make warm-ups students don’t hate, aim for five design features.

1) Repetition Without Boredom

Repeat formats, not exact problems. Students like knowing what the “lane” is. They don’t need to do the same exact question every day.

2) Success Guaranteed Early

Include one easiest problem first that helps most students get rolling within 30 seconds.

3) Visible Thinking

Use models, number lines, fraction strips, place-value charts, or equation frames. Visible thinking reduces “I don’t know what to do” frustration.

4) Choice in a Small Way

Give small options so students feel agency:

  • “Choose A or B”
  • “Pick one word problem to solve”
  • “Circle the method you’ll use”

5) Fast Feedback

If feedback arrives 4 days later, it’s too late. Warm-up feedback should be immediate or same-day.

A Ten-Minute Warm-up Menu (Pick 3–4 Types Per Week)

Instead of reinventing the wheel every day, choose a small set of warm-up types and rotate them. Students build mental shortcuts because the routine becomes familiar.

Warm-up Type A: Number Sense Sprint (4–6 problems)

Best for: place value, rounding, comparisons, multiples/factors, quick mental math.

Example set (5th grade):

  • Which is larger: 6.08 or 6.088?
  • Round 7.934 to the nearest tenth.
  • Find the next three numbers in the pattern: 12, 24, 36, __, __, __
  • What is the value of 5 in 5,407?
  • 48 ÷ 6 = __

Warm-up Type B: Fraction/Decimal Quick Work

Best for: equivalence, comparing, ordering, and simple operations.

Example set:

  • Write 0.6 as a fraction in simplest form.
  • Which is greater: 3/5 or 2/3? (Show a model.)
  • 0.75 + 0.25 = __
  • Put these in order from least to greatest: 1/2, 0.45, 0.5

Warm-up Type C: Word Problem Micro-Reads (1 short passage, 1–2 questions)

Best for: problem-solving, drawing, and checking.

Example set:

Maya buys 3 bags of apples. Each bag has 6 apples. How many apples does Maya buy?
Then: Is your answer reasonable? Explain in 1 sentence.

Warm-up Type D: Geometry and Measurement Momentum

Best for: perimeter/area concepts, angle basics, coordinate ideas.

Example set:

  • A rectangle has a length of 9 cm and width of 4 cm. Find perimeter.
  • Identify the types of angles shown: acute, right, obtuse (three small drawings).
  • Find the distance on a number line from 2 to 9.

Warm-up Type E: “Fix the Mistake” (One wrong solution, one correction)

Best for: conceptual understanding and attention to detail.

Example set:

Student says: 48 ÷ 6 = 10
Explain the mistake and write the correct answer.

This one is a favorite because kids get to feel like math detectives. And who doesn’t love catching someone being wrong?

A Complete Ten-minute Warm-up Template (Ready to Adapt)

Use this format for every warm-up page for consistency.

Warm-up Page Sections

  1. Today’s Goal (1 sentence)
  2. Problem 1 (Quick Start)
  3. Problems 2–4 (Core practice)
  4. Problem 5 (Reasoning or Fix-the-Mistake)
  5. Last step: Check + Self-rating

Here’s how it might look in student language:

  • Goal: Today we practice fraction and decimal relationships.
  • Problem 1: Write 0.8 as a fraction.
  • Problems 2–4: Compare and compute.
  • Problem 5: Fix the mistake.
  • Check: Circle one: Got it / Almost there / Need help

This self-rating step is gold. You’re building a feedback culture instead of a “correct-or-wrong” culture.

What Differentiation Looks Like Without Doing 5 Different Worksheets

Differentiation doesn’t have to mean you create multiple versions that take forever. You can differentiate through supports embedded into the same warm-up.

Strategy 1: Use “Same Skill, Different Scaffolds”

Keep the skill constant, vary the support.

For instance, on a fraction comparison warm-up:

  • Students who need support get a fraction strip diagram.
  • Others get blanks and create their own model.

Strategy 2: Add an “Extension Lane”

All students do the core problems. Then:

  • If finished early, they choose a quick extension:
    • “Explain your thinking”
    • “Solve a similar problem”
    • “Create your own comparison question”

Strategy 3: Offer a Choice of Representation

For one problem, let students choose:

  • write an equation,
  • draw a model,
  • or explain with words.

When students choose the channel that fits them, motivation improves without lowering expectations.

Detailed Example: A 5th Grade Week of Ten-minute Warm-ups

Below is an example week plan. You can use it as a starting point and swap in your current unit vocabulary.

Monday: Number Sense Sprint + One Reasoning Check

  • Problem 1: Quick comparison (decimals or whole numbers)
  • Problems 2–4: Place value and rounding
  • Problem 5: Fix the mistake (e.g., wrong rounding)
  • Self-check: Got it / Need help

Tuesday: Fractions + Decimal Equivalence

  • Problem 1: Convert fraction to decimal (or vice versa)
  • Problems 2–4: Compare and order
  • Problem 5: Short reasoning: “Which is closer to 1? Explain.”
  • Self-check

Wednesday: Multiplication/Division Relationships

  • Problem 1: Factor pair or quick division facts
  • Problems 2–4: Multi-digit operation with a model option
  • Problem 5: Word problem micro-read
  • Self-check

Thursday: Geometry Momentum + Measurement

  • Problem 1: Angle identification
  • Problems 2–4: Perimeter/area concept checks
  • Problem 5: Fix the mistake in an area/perimeter answer
  • Self-check

Friday: Mixed Review With Choice

  • Problem 1–3: Core review
  • Problem 4: Word problem
  • Problem 5: Choose:
    • A reasoning explanation
    • OR an extension problem
  • Self-check + celebration

The secret ingredient is not the specific problems. It’s that the routine pattern stays stable.

The “Minimum Viable Warm-up” If You’re Short on Time

If you’re thinking, “This is great, but I’m overwhelmed,” here’s the simplest version that still works.

Create a one-page warm-up with:

  • 3 quick problems
  • 1 reasoning problem
  • 1 self-check

That’s it. Students will still build momentum and you’ll still get formative feedback.

If you repeat the same structure for two weeks, you’ll notice behavior changes. Less confusion. More independence. Fewer “What do we do?” questions.

How to Check Work Quickly Without Slowing Everything Down

You want feedback, not a 20-minute grading marathon. Use systems that match the warm-up purpose.

Option 1: Self-Check With an Answer Strip

  • Put answers on the board or on the side of the page.
  • Students compare and circle one adjustment if needed.

Option 2: “Teacher Spot Check”

Pick a few problems each day to spot check.

  • You don’t need to see every answer.
  • You’re looking for common errors to target in the next lesson.

Option 3: Collect Only Problem 5

Problem 5 is usually reasoning or fixing a mistake. Collect it and leave the others ungraded.

This saves time and increases attention to the hardest part, which is where understanding lives.

Common Student Reactions (and What to Do About Them)

Even with a great routine, you’ll hit predictable issues. Here’s how to respond.

“This is too easy.”

Some students bored by basic practice want a challenge. Give them an extension lane:

  • “If you finished early, do Extension 1.”

Also, include one “challenge” problem that feels like a puzzle, not an upgrade to difficulty. Fix-the-mistake problems are perfect for this.

“I don’t know how to start.”

That’s usually a design problem. Students can’t start because the directions or first steps are unclear.

Fix it by making Problem 1 a launch:

  • “Find the value of the underlined digit…”
  • “Choose the bigger number…”
  • “Draw a quick model…”

“I rush and get it wrong.”

Create a checking habit that doesn’t feel like punishment:

  • “Before you check, underline the operation you used.”
  • “Circle your final answer. Then ask: Does it make sense?”

This teaches metacognition, which is the difference between “I guessed” and “I know.”

“It’s taking too long.”

If most students are not finishing, your warm-up is too big or too complex.

Cut:

  • reduce the number of problems,
  • or simplify representations,
  • or replace one multi-step problem with two quick ones.

Expert Insights, Translated Into Classroom Actions

Morning routines and attention are rooted in brain and learning science, but you don’t need a neuroscience degree to benefit. A few big ideas show up across education research:

1) Routine reduces cognitive load

When the format is stable, students don’t waste energy deciding what to do. That means more working memory goes into solving.

Action: keep headings and problem types consistent even if the content changes.

2) Immediate feedback improves learning

When students correct mistakes quickly, the “error memory” doesn’t stick around as long.

Action: build in self-check or same-day correction.

3) Short practice distributed over time beats cramming

Warm-ups act like spaced practice. Over weeks, that adds up.

Action: do this daily or almost daily, even if some days are easier.

4) Executive function support helps everyone

Some students struggle with organization, sequencing, or staying on task. Visual and structured formats can reduce those barriers.

Action: use a consistent warm-up template and a predictable check step.

Ten Common 5th Grade Warm-up Skill Targets (Rotate These)

Use these as a “skill rotation list” so you never wonder what to practice.

  • Place value (millions, decimals to thousandths)
  • Rounding (whole numbers and decimals)
  • Fraction equivalence (including simplest form)
  • Comparing fractions with unlike denominators (using models or benchmarks)
  • Decimal comparisons and ordering
  • Multiplication and division relationships (fact families, partial products, estimation)
  • Word problem strategies (underlining quantities, choosing operations, checking reasonableness)
  • Perimeter and area (concept vs. “plug and chug”)
  • Angle basics (acute, right, obtuse)
  • Coordinate basics (using pairs or simple graphs)

Ready-to-Use Warm-up Problem Examples (Copy and Customize)

Here are bite-sized examples you can place into a daily warm-up. Mix and match.

Number Sense

  • 3,500 is how many thousands?
  • Round 12.345 to the nearest tenth.
  • Which is greater: 0.72 or 0.707?

Fractions and Decimals

  • 2/4 = __ / __ (equivalent fraction)
  • Order from least to greatest: 0.3, 1/4, 0.25
  • 0.9 ÷ 3 = __

Operations

  • 6 × 24 = __ (show one strategy)
  • 84 ÷ 6 = __ (then estimate: is your answer reasonable?)

Word Problems

  • A store sells 8 boxes of crayons. Each box has 12 crayons. How many crayons?
  • Students read 15 pages on Monday and 17 pages on Tuesday. How many pages total?

Geometry

  • Find the perimeter of a rectangle: 7 m by 9 m.
  • Draw one right angle you see in the room and label it.

Fix the Mistake

  • Student: “To add fractions, multiply denominators.” Correct the statement.

How to Handle Students Who Finish in 60 Seconds (and Those Who Need Help)

Fast finishers

Give them meaningful next steps:

  • “Explain your reasoning in one sentence.”
  • “Create a similar problem.”
  • “Check your solution two ways.”

If fast finishers are forced into idle waiting, they’ll fill the silence with social chaos.

Students who need help

Your goal isn’t to do it for them. It’s to break the barrier.

Use supports like:

  • a partially completed example,
  • a model diagram,
  • or a step prompt.

Example step prompts:

  • “What is the question asking you to find?”
  • “What operation matches the story?”
  • “Does your answer fit the size you expected?”

Common Mistakes Teachers Make With Morning Work (So You Can Avoid Them)

Here are the pitfalls that quietly turn morning work into a daily headache.

  • Making it too long (10 minutes becomes 18)
  • Using new formats constantly (students can’t build independence)
  • Ignoring feedback (students don’t learn from mistakes)
  • Over-scaffolding (students never build muscle)
  • Calling it “practice” without a goal (no buy-in)
  • Turning it into test mode (instant anxiety)

The best morning routines feel like teaching, not testing.

A Simple Script You Can Use Tomorrow Morning

If you want a ready-to-go start, try this:

  1. “Good morning. Today our warm-up is about fractions and decimals.”
  2. “You’ll have 10 minutes. Problem 1 is a quick start.”
  3. “Do your best work. Check at the end.”
  4. “If you finish early, do the extension.”
  5. “Let’s go.”

Then set the timer. Stop talking. Let the routine do the work.
